Feinstein had a trailblazing political career that was filled with milestones.

Dianne Feinstein speaks during a Senate Judiciary Committee hearing on Sept. 6. Photo: Drew Angerer/Getty ImagesThe big picture:

"There are few women who can be called senator, chairman, mayor, wife, mom and grandmother," her office said in a statement Friday. "Senator Feinstein was a force of nature who made an incredible impact on our country and her home state."Dianne Feinstein takes over as President of the San Francisco Board of Supervisors, Jan. 8, 1970.

Dianne Feinstein being sworn in as the new mayor of San Francisco in December 1978. Photo: John O'Hara/San Francisco Chronicle via Getty Images
